Description
- Robert Doisneau
- SELECTED IMAGES
- gelatin silver prints
a group of 7 photographs, each signed in ink in the margin, titled, dated, and initialed in ink on the reverse, 1945-57, printed later (7)
Condition
These photographs are in generally excellent condition. In raking light, a few tiny deposits of original retouching are visible on some of the prints. The corners of some of the prints are bumped, and there are very minor areas of edge rippling. The photographs are as follows:
Les Enfants de la Place Hebert, 1957
Les Glaneurs de Charbon, 1945
La Concierge aux Lunettes, 1945 - There is a one-inch scratch at the bottom left of the print that does not appear to break the emulsion.
L'Enfer, 1952 - There is a small handling crease near the lower edge of the image.
Midi a la Fonderie Rudier, 1949
Picasso et Françoise Gilot, 1952
Les Animaux Supérieurs, 1954
There are occasional stray pen marks on the reverse of the prints.
These images are reproduced in 'Three Seconds from Eternity,' pp. 46, 81, and 143; 'Doisneau Paris,' pp. 189 and 565; and 'Retrospective,' pl. 67.
